Nightlife supremo to tell tales from the dancefloor at Altrincham book signing

Lord's memoir is published this Thursday.

Sacha Lord, co-creator of the Parklife festival and The Warehouse Project and one of the most important figures on the Manchester nightlife scene, is to hold a book signing in Altrincham to mark the launch of his new memoir.

The event, organised by Altrincham BID, will take place at The Con Club on Thursday 25th April, 6.30-7.30pm.

Altrincham-born Lord's book, Tales from the Dancefloor, is published on Thursday.

“I’ve been shot at in a drive-by shooting, bundled into a car by gangsters and had death threats," said Lord, who is also currently Manchester's Nighttime Economy Advisor.

"I’ve been sued and broke, I’ve had to deal with an army of rats who were high on cocaine, had £130,000 stolen in an armed robbery and been targeted by a Romanian organised crime gang.

“I’ve been lucky to have been in the eye of the storm of a musical and cultural revolution, to have some of the most incredible life-affirming experiences, to meet most of my musical heroes and to have thrown some of the biggest parties this country has ever seen.

"This book will reveal everything which happened behind the scenes, the good, the bad and the ugly.”

Attendees at the Altrincham event will have the chance to meet Lord in person, purchase signed copies of his book, and engage in a Q&A discussion.
